Transaction 50c60195718def6688a76c7b7e1a393f4fed52e0fcb214353fd7221fc29ae9b2
1 Input
1 Output
-
50c60195718def6688a76c7b7e1a393f4fed52e0fcb214353fd7221fc29ae9b2:0
- value
- 3682212
- script pubkey
- OP_0 OP_PUSHBYTES_20 70d4316044ba4b4196ef17901eb0a9dcc5f8fce3
- address
- bc1qwr2rzczyhf95r9h0z7gpav9fmnzl3l8re34k8a